Jubilee Walk
Meanders through Durham's historic heart and riverside woodland, linking the city centre with panoramic views from the viaduct and cathedral. Mostly flat or gently sloping paths with some stepped sections and cobbles near the cathedral precinct – manageable for older children but tricky with buggies. Dogs welcome throughout, though keep them close near busy tourist spots. Outstanding medieval architecture combined with peaceful River Wear scenery makes this a proper highlight of the North East,
